Standout Results for Bath College
In a show of force for why vocational qualifications are the perfect choice for so many students, Bath College’s results for the 22/23 academic year yielded much to be happy about.
Over half of the students on the BTEC Diploma in Production Art and BTEC Engineering courses achieved a ‘Distinction’, and not a single Music or Animal Care student failed their course.
​
Concurrently, Bath College has always taken pride in supporting students who struggled in mainstream education, offering retakes for English and Maths GCSEs. The number of students achieving grades 4 or above beat the national average, showing that if students are able to learn in their chosen environment, they are able to do so much more.
'94% of T Level students passed their courses, beating the national pass rate'
As one of the first colleges in the region to roll out the new T Level qualifications, it should come as no surprise that students enrolled on T Levels at Bath College performed well. 94% of T Level students passed their courses, beating the national pass rate, and almost three quarters of T Level Health students achieved a ‘Distinction’. Meanwhile, almost three quarters of T Level Education and Childcare students also secured grades at C or above. Bath College has steadily expanded its T Level course offerings, recognising that the format is ideal for so many learners, and this is a trend that will only continue.
